> So, it looks like there could be a problem in the error path, plausibly
> fixed by this patch:
> 
> commit 656ecc16e8fc2ab44b3d70e3fcc197a7020d0ca5
> Author: Haren Myneni <haren at linux.vnet.ibm.com>
> Date:   Wed Jun 13 00:32:40 2018 -0700
> 
>     crypto/nx: Initialize 842 high and normal RxFIFO control registers
>     
>     NX increments readOffset by FIFO size in receive FIFO control register
>     when CRB is read. But the index in RxFIFO has to match with the
>     corresponding entry in FIFO maintained by VAS in kernel. Otherwise NX
>     may be processing incorrect CRBs and can cause CRB timeout.
>     
>     VAS FIFO offset is 0 when the receive window is opened during
>     initialization. When the module is reloaded or in kexec boot, readOffset
>     in FIFO control register may not match with VAS entry. This patch adds
>     nx_coproc_init OPAL call to reset readOffset and queued entries in FIFO
>     control register for both high and normal FIFOs.
>     
>     Signed-off-by: Haren Myneni <haren at us.ibm.com>
>     [mpe: Fixup uninitialized variable warning]
>     Signed-off-by: Michael Ellerman <mpe at ellerman.id.au>
> 
> $ git describe --contains 656ecc16e8fc2ab44b3d70e3fcc197a7020d0ca5
> v4.19-rc1~24^2~50
> 
> 
> Which was never backported to any stable release, so probably needs to
> be for v4.14 through v4.18. Notably, Ubuntu is on v4.15 and it doesn't
> seem to have picked up the patch. I'm opening an Ubuntu bug for this.

Thanks Stewart. Missed this in stable releases and I will work on it. Merged in Ubuntu 18.04.x kernel recently and will be in the next update.

Also need
 
commit 6e708000ec2c93c2bde6a46aa2d6c3e80d4eaeb9
Author: Haren Myneni <haren at linux.vnet.ibm.com>
Date:   Wed Jun 13 00:28:57 2018 -0700

    powerpc/powernv: Export opal_check_token symbol

    Export opal_check_token symbol for modules to check the availability
    of OPAL calls before using them.
